Output 16917b6f46658e5084462cfe24dbb9a8c832d2d4b9eb5e3630e0fb25b4867131:1

value
506176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2132e8f83a77ea95c6953a74caf3cb81daa51a9b OP_EQUALVERIFY OP_CHECKSIG
address
142YHd4rDHbouqHvRbxsPowiJ7KQ4xTFc1
transaction
16917b6f46658e5084462cfe24dbb9a8c832d2d4b9eb5e3630e0fb25b4867131
spent
true